They also told me that from where it is leaking, they think that it might just be one or more of the gaskets that it is leaking from, so I bought them to try that route first.Depending on where it’s leaking, u can’t fix it in place and it needs to come off inorder to be repaired..
If it’s leaking between the aluminum hsg and the steel head, U DEFINITELY CANT FIX IT INPLACE.
If u remove the 4 screws to release the head, all the guts WILL FALL OUT.!
